X-Git-Url: https://gerrit.akraino.org/r/gitweb?a=blobdiff_plain;ds=sidebyside;f=src%2Ffoundation%2Fscripts%2Fk8s_master.sh;h=ab9a289017e4c0f45c7eda5a7c5c559b033e8d54;hb=6a5afa9d9cc2d8643ff8d3c939051f08af0e61e7;hp=5eb90824fe5ba515c22d0be323a84fc18bab950b;hpb=9c50c90d2074080bd5bdb46589fe3fdc82a45688;p=iec.git diff --git a/src/foundation/scripts/k8s_master.sh b/src/foundation/scripts/k8s_master.sh index 5eb9082..ab9a289 100755 --- a/src/foundation/scripts/k8s_master.sh +++ b/src/foundation/scripts/k8s_master.sh @@ -10,9 +10,6 @@ if [ -z "${MGMT_IP}" ]; then exit 1 fi -#Add extra flags to Kubelet -sed '/Environment=\"KUBELET_CONFIG_ARGS/a\Environment=\"KUBELET_EXTRA_ARGS=--fail-swap-on=false --feature-gates HugePages=false\"' -i /etc/systemd/system/kubelet.service.d/10-kubeadm.conf - if ! kubectl get nodes; then sudo kubeadm config images pull sudo kubeadm init \ @@ -22,12 +19,15 @@ if ! kubectl get nodes; then if [ "$(id -u)" = 0 ]; then echo "export KUBECONFIG=/etc/kubernetes/admin.conf" | \ - tee -a "${HOME}/.profile" + tee -a "${HOME}/.bashrc" # shellcheck disable=SC1090 - source "${HOME}/.profile" - else - mkdir -p "${HOME}/.kube" - sudo cp -i /etc/kubernetes/admin.conf "${HOME}/.kube/config" - sudo chown "$(id -u)":"$(id -g)" "${HOME}/.kube/config" + source "${HOME}/.bashrc" fi + + mkdir -p "${HOME}/.kube" + sudo cp /etc/kubernetes/admin.conf "${HOME}/.kube/config" + sudo chown "$(id -u)":"$(id -g)" "${HOME}/.kube/config" + + sleep 5 + sudo swapon -a fi